在当今信息技术飞速发展的时代,Linux操作系统凭借其稳定、安全、开源等优势,已成为服务器、云计算等领域的主流选择。作为Linux系统的基础,掌握Linux常用代码对于开发者来说至关重要。本文将针对Linux常用代码进行解析,帮助读者开启高效编程之旅。
一、Linux常用命令
1. 文件操作
(1)创建文件:touch filename
(2)查看文件cat filename
(3)查看文件详细属性:ls -l filename
(4)复制文件:cp sourcefile destfile
(5)移动文件:mv sourcefile destfile
(6)删除文件:rm filename
2. 目录操作
(1)创建目录:mkdir directoryname
(2)查看目录ls directoryname
(3)进入目录:cd directoryname
(4)退出目录:cd ..
3. 磁盘操作
(1)查看磁盘空间:df -h
(2)查看文件占用空间:du -h filename
(3)压缩文件:tar -czvf filename.tar.gz directoryname
(4)解压文件:tar -xzvf filename.tar.gz
4. 网络操作
(1)查看本机IP地址:ifconfig
(2)查看路由表:route -n
(3)查看端口占用:netstat -tunlp
二、Shell脚本编程
Shell脚本是一种文本文件,其中包含了一系列Linux命令,用于自动化执行任务。以下是Shell脚本中常用的代码:
1. 变量赋值与引用
(1)变量赋值:varname=value
(2)变量引用:$varname
2. 条件判断
(1)if条件判断:if [ 条件 ]; then
(2)case条件判断:case varname in
3. 循环语句
(1)for循环:for varname in item1 item2 ...; do
(2)while循环:while [ 条件 ]; do
三、Linux开发工具
1. Git:用于版本控制,方便团队协作。
2. Maven:自动化构建、测试和部署。
3. Gradle:基于Groovy的构建工具,适用于Android开发。
4. Docker:容器化技术,简化应用部署。
Linux常用代码是开发者必备技能,掌握这些代码有助于提高工作效率,降低开发成本。通过本文的学习,相信读者已对Linux常用代码有了初步了解。在今后的工作中,不断积累实践经验,定能成为一名优秀的Linux开发者。正如Linux创始人Linus Torvalds所言:“Linux是所有人的操作系统,因为它是由所有人共同打造的。”让我们携手共进,为Linux生态的发展贡献力量。